An intrauterine device (IUD) is a small, T-shaped birth control device that is inserted into the uterus to prevent pregnancy.
Key Features
- Long-acting contraception
- Highly effective
- Does not require daily maintenance
- Reversible
Pros
- Highly effective in preventing pregnancy
- Long-acting contraception - can last for several years
- Does not interfere with sexual activity
- Reversible - fertility returns quickly after removal
Cons
- May cause side effects such as cramping or irregular bleeding in some individuals
- Requires insertion by a healthcare provider
- Does not protect against sexually transmitted infections (STIs)
